Output e00666c6c6bd16798ed0a7b11c2680c0a33a77efc152f95a38091da4c6b190bd:2

value
327591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9fba393d94dc260ec4c36a01a2b2e53d236862 OP_EQUAL
address
3HFC9DEXh9X272SMnNqfgzSAdyYZDozuXK
transaction
e00666c6c6bd16798ed0a7b11c2680c0a33a77efc152f95a38091da4c6b190bd
spent
true